首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当我按下“提交”按钮时,JavaScript代码没有执行

当您按下“提交”按钮时,JavaScript代码没有执行可能是由于以下几个原因导致的:

  1. JavaScript代码错误:请检查您的JavaScript代码是否存在语法错误或逻辑错误。可以使用浏览器的开发者工具(如Chrome的开发者工具)来查看控制台输出,以便定位错误并进行修复。
  2. JavaScript文件未正确引入:确保您的HTML文件中正确引入了包含JavaScript代码的文件。可以使用<script>标签将JavaScript文件引入到HTML文件中,例如:
代码语言:txt
复制
<script src="script.js"></script>
  1. 事件绑定错误:确认您是否正确地将JavaScript代码与提交按钮的点击事件绑定。可以使用addEventListener方法来绑定事件,例如:
代码语言:txt
复制
document.getElementById("submitBtn").addEventListener("click", function() {
  // 执行相应的代码
});
  1. 页面加载顺序问题:如果您的JavaScript代码位于页面底部,可能会导致在代码执行之前用户点击了提交按钮。可以将JavaScript代码放置在DOMContentLoaded事件处理程序中,以确保在页面加载完成后再执行代码,例如:
代码语言:txt
复制
document.addEventListener("DOMContentLoaded", function() {
  // 执行相应的代码
});
  1. 浏览器兼容性问题:不同的浏览器对JavaScript的支持程度可能有所不同。请确保您的JavaScript代码在目标浏览器中得到支持。可以使用现代的JavaScript语法和功能,并使用Babel等工具进行转译以提供更好的兼容性。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less):腾讯云云函数是一种无需管理服务器即可运行代码的计算服务,可用于处理提交按钮点击事件等后端逻辑。了解更多:云函数产品介绍
  • COS(对象存储):腾讯云对象存储(COS)是一种安全、高可靠、低成本的云端存储服务,可用于存储和管理前端或后端代码中的静态资源。了解更多:对象存储产品介绍
  • API 网关:腾讯云 API 网关是一种托管的 API 服务,可用于构建和部署具有高性能、高可用性的 API 接口。可以将提交按钮点击事件的请求通过 API 网关转发到后端逻辑处理。了解更多:API 网关产品介绍
  • CVM(云服务器):腾讯云云服务器是一种可弹性伸缩的云端计算服务,可用于部署和运行后端代码。了解更多:云服务器产品介绍

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• ajax提交等待服务器响应友好提示信息的实现

    众所周知,在客户端向服务器发送AJAX请求时,会有一个等待服务器响应的过程,在网络环境好而且服务器负荷小的时候,业务逻辑不大太复杂的请求可能一下子就处理完并返回响应结果了,但当网络环境不理想或请求涉及到大量的运算时,服务器响应的时间或许就会比较漫长了,特别对于正在操作,正期待操作结果的用户来说,这段等待时候是无比的漫长,如果你没有过这样的操作体验,你回想一下约会时别人迟到的时候或有急事出门时在公交站苦苦等车的滋味,相信你就能感同身受了,而让用户忍受如此煎熬,对于强调用户体验的Web2.0时代,是大忌,是追求“为用户创造价值,让用户享受电子商务所带来的方便快捷”为宗旨的我所不能接受的。虽然,我不能改变客观环境因素带来的长响应时间,但我可以告诉用户系统正在做什么,让他们感受到,系统很在乎他们的感受,并愿意亲切地和他们交流的,而不是传统的软件那样,死板、霸道、冷冰冰的,好了,不多说大道理了,看看我的做法吧。

    03
    领券